About the Location

The city of Granada has one of the most dramatic locations in Spain, poised below the magnificent snowcapped peaks of the Sierra Nevada. It is the perfect setting for one of Europe's most stunning monuments – The Alhambra Palace, the romantic palace-fortress built by the last Muslims to rule in Spain. The residence is in the Realejo-San Matias neighborhood, the old Jewish quarter. It is situated on a calm, residential street at the foothills of the Alhambra Palace, which is a 15-minute walk uphill. It is an easy 15 minutes’ walk to the center of the city and all its attractions. Federico García Lorca Granada Airport is a 30-minute taxi ride.

Granada, Andalusia

Flamenco, tapas and the show-stopping Alhambra

This captivating city in southern Spain’s Andalusia region is dominated by the UNESCO world heritage site of the 13th-century Moorish palace of Alhambra. Kids (under 12s go free) will love running around the Arab influenced Generalife Gardens, gazing at the view and getting school on history. Dig around the souks and wares in Albaícin, a medieval warren of streets, try local dishes such as remòjon, an orange-based salad with cod, or eat tapas in one of the city’s many lively bars. Explore Granada’s Science Park with a butterfly farm and planetarium, picnic in the lovely Federico Garcia Lorca Park or, if it gets too hot, hit one of the many beautiful beaches on the Costa Tropical.
